Hi,大家好,上一期介绍了文件系统对象,从示例演示可以看到,通过文件系统对象,可以利用代码快速的创建,复制,粘贴,移动文件夹等操作,同时示例中还涉及到了对文文件对象的简单操作,演示代码中创建了一个文本文件对象,并写入了一串字符串到文本文件中。
鉴于文本文件易于创建,读取,保存,格式简单,同时兼容性较好,能应用在很多的场合,无需安装额外的软件就能操作,因此,在对文本文件进行抽象后,形成了文本对象,便于通过代码来自动化操作文本文件。
文本文件对象不仅提供了常用的文件操作,例如文件的创建,打开,关闭等操作,还提供了编辑操作,读取,写入,移动光标等操作,同时还提供了返回当前光标所在的行,列等位置信息,有了这些支持,已经可以满足绝大部分情况下对文本文件操作的需求了。
虽然此前的例子的中已经演示了如何创建文本对象,这里还是再次提一下,方便以后查看:
'定义一个通用对象用于表示文件系统对象Dim fs As Object'定义一个通用对象用于表示文本文件对象Dim file As Object'创建文件系统对象并绑定到通用对象Set fs = CreateObject("Scripting.FileSystemObject")'创建文本文件test.txt对象并绑定到通用对象Set file = fs.CreateTextFile("D:\test.t